Some of Earth’s most resilient creatures made it through the catastrophic asteroid strike that wiped out the dinosaurs. But survival did not guarantee success. Just a few hundred thousand years later, many of these species disappeared, undone not by a single violent event but by a planet that kept changing.
Survival after the asteroid
The asteroid impact 66 million years ago triggered global fires, tsunamis, and years of darkness. While dinosaurs vanished, fossil records show that several marine and small-bodied species endured the immediate aftermath.
Scientists say these organisms possessed traits that helped them cope with short-term chaos, including flexible diets, smaller body sizes, and faster reproduction.

What actually caused their extinction
According to palaeontologists, the real danger came later. After the dust settled, Earth entered a period of long-lasting environmental instability.
Researchers point to multiple overlapping pressures:
Persistent climate warming and cooling cycles
Ocean chemistry changes, including acidification
Disrupted food chains that never fully recovered
Unlike an asteroid, these changes were gradual but relentless, leaving little room for adaptation.
Major outcome: Slow environmental shifts ultimately proved more lethal than sudden catastrophe.
Why scientists are rethinking mass extinctions
Traditionally, mass extinctions were linked to dramatic events. However, this research highlights that prolonged stress can finish off species that initially survive disaster.
Experts note that extinction is often a process, not a moment, unfolding over thousands of years rather than days.
This perspective is now influencing how scientists study other extinction periods in Earth’s history.
